Bay Window Renovation: Enhancing Your Home's Aesthetic and Functionality
Bay windows are architectural gems that can improve the looks and performance of any home. Featuring a protruding design that allows for a scenic view of the outdoors, bay windows use a special way to bring natural light into a home. Renovating a bay window can enhance energy performance, provide extra seating or storage, and ultimately increase the worth of a property. This article will dig into the numerous factors to consider included with bay window renovation, consisting of styles, products, expenses, and the renovation process itself.

Understanding Bay Windows
Before diving into the renovation process, it's necessary to comprehend what specifies a bay window. Usually, a bay window consists of three primary components:
- Center Window: A big repaired pane that provides a broad view.
- Side Windows: Two additional windows on either side that are normally operable, allowing for ventilation.
- Base or Seat: A ledge or seating area that can be integrated into the design.

Preparation Your Bay Window Renovation
Prior to embarking on a bay window renovation, homeowners need to think about a number of elements to ensure a successful project.
1. Examining the Condition of the Existing Window
Before renovations are started, it is essential to assess the condition of the current bay window. House owners must examine for indications of wear and tear, moisture damage, and structural integrity. If the window frame is decaying or if there are extensive drafts, it might be necessary to change the whole unit rather than simply refurbish.
2. Setting a Budget
It's essential to develop a reasonable budget plan before starting any renovation job. Costs can differ widely based upon design options, products, and labor. Here's a basic spending plan breakdown:
Item | Approximated Cost Range |
---|---|
Window Frame Replacement |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,000 |
Glass Replacement | ₤ 200 - ₤ 600 |
Trim and Molding | ₤ 100 - ₤ 500 |
Labor Costs | ₤ 500 - ₤ 2,000 |
Total Estimated Renovation Cost | ₤ 1,200 - ₤ 4,100 |

The Renovation Process
As soon as planning and preparation are complete, house owners can start the renovation procedure. This can be broken down into a couple of crucial actions.
Preparation and Measurements: Before any work begins, measuring the existing bay window and going over particular design components with contractors is essential.
Choosing a Contractor: Selecting an experienced contractor who specializes in window installations is essential for attaining ideal results. Acquiring several quotes and examining past work can aid in the decision-making procedure.
Removing Old Window Components: The existing frame and glass will need to be thoroughly eliminated. It's necessary to make sure that no extra damage is caused to surrounding areas.
Installing the New Window: New frames and glass will be set up. Appropriate insulation is essential throughout this action to avoid future drafts and make sure energy performance.
Finishing Touches: Finalizing the renovation with trim, molding, and any additional features like window seats or racks will finalize the visual appeal of the bay window.
